The Petri Net Course ==================== organised 23-25 June prior to the "36th International Conference on Application and Theory of Petri Nets and Concurrency" in Brussels, Belgium, 24-26 June 2015 (http://www.ulb.ac.be/di/verif/pn2015acsd2015/index.html) This is a three day course - worth 3 ECTS - primarily aimed at master and PhD students, but also open for others. In particular, the two modules on Tuesday: "From Symmetric Nets to Symmetric Nets with Bags" and "Modeling, Synthesis and Verification of Hardware" can each be followed as an independent full-day Tutorial. http://www.ulb.ac.be//di/verif/pn2015acsd2015/satellite.html#course Organisation ============ The course offers a thorough introduction to Petri Nets in four half-day modules on Sunday and Monday, June 21 and June 22, 2015. On Tuesday June 23, there is a choice from two full-day tutorial modules devoted to new developments and/or applications. For participating in the entire course including preparation and examination, three credit points (ECTS) will be awarded by Leiden University (The Netherlands). Each module of the course can also be taken separately, without any credits.
